How is inline positioning different from the normal positioning of components inside joomla?

Inline positioning in Joomla means that elements are placed next to each other without taking up a new line. This can be achieved by using HTML inline elements or CSS inline-block properties. Normal positioning, on the other hand, refers to the default block-level positioning of components where they take up a new line and occupy vertical space.
